An Investigation of the Sorption/Desorption of Organics from Natural Waters by Solid Adsorbents and Anion Exchangers

摘要

The results of laboratory and operational tests at thermal and nuclear power stations on anion exchangers and solid adsorbents of makeup water treatment plants with regard to the sorption/desorption of organic substances in natural water and condensate are presented.The resins Amberlite~(TM~1) IRA-67,IRA-900,IRA-958CI,Purolite~R~2 A-500P,Dowex~(TM~3) Marathon,and others were tested.Retention of up to 60-80 % of the "organic" material on the anion exchangers and organic absorbers installed at different places in the technological scheme of the water processing unit was attained.The possibility of a partial "poisoning" of the resins and the degradation of the working characteristics over the first year of operation are discussed.
